Output ec22991636d8c760a042c67187509a28bea4efb694d71cc437aa648ad61e013b:4

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ec67225b41169e8d3095f598213967e45f40489 OP_EQUAL
address
3MzwfPhLG9DuYc1uduBZsJpEw6GQ5vsEgL
transaction
ec22991636d8c760a042c67187509a28bea4efb694d71cc437aa648ad61e013b
confirmations
393761
spent
true